CAVMAT explores the interaction between light and quantum materials to enhance their properties for technological applications. The project aims to develop new methods for controlling quantum systems using light, addressing limitations in current techniques to enable advancements in quantum technology.
Light-matter coupling has the potential to modify functional properties of quantum materials to yield the tunability required for quantum-technological applications.
However, light-matter control concepts, such as Floquet engineering and light-induced phase transitions, suffer from the requirement of strong laser driving and the lack of coherence on long time scales.
Overcoming these key limitations through advancing the infant field of cavity quantum materials is the central objective of CAVMAT…
